The TRUE CABLE Cat6 Riser (CMR) is a high-performance 1000ft Ethernet cable designed for optimal speed and reliability. With solid bare copper conductors and a bandwidth of 550MHz, it supports up to 10 Gigabit speeds in suitable environments. Ideal for indoor use, this cable is riser rated for safety and comes in a convenient, hassle-free packaging.

Good quality cables. Very well wrapped spool no crossing over at all. I'm not a pro at running cables or wires but I found it easy to work with. I started my first cable run by unrolling out a set length then pulling it to the end location from inside. It was at this point when the cable looped over itself and kinked when pulled. I had another person uncoil it straight and feed it while I pull. My next run I tried pulling from the reel and it uncoils nice and straight no kinks this time. Lesson learned no need to pre unroll cable just pull right from the reel.It has the right amount of flexibility. not too stiff but also not too flimsy either. The 4 pairs are very well twisted together and seperated by the plastic spine helps reduce crosstalk. It can kink on something like a wall stud when pulling if I try hard enough. It's also marked with 2 foot length increments stating at 500 feet and decreases with use.
